Believed to be the only one ever produced and most likely made by Grenfell, who manufactured all the Bluebird Team overalls, as an advanced sample, in preparation for Campbell's intended presence at the London Boat Show later in 1967, following his world water speed record attempt on Conniston Water. The canvas material is date stamped and would have been available when made, for Campbell's approval while he was up in the Lakes from November 1966. The "Campbell Crew" metaphor dates back to Sir Malcolm's record breaking days when his mechanics wore orange armbands labelled as "Campbell Crew".
